Airy的技术空间 https://bbs.21ic.com/?91297 [收藏] [复制] [RSS]

日志

很棒的工具--git

已有 507 次阅读2009-4-17 03:20 |个人分类:其他|系统分类:嵌入式系统

    最近开始用git,很好很强大

    之前没有用过版本控制软件,因为大多是单人开发的项目,问题倒不大,升级个版本就把项目文件夹复制一下。只是多个版本的代码保存起来比较占空间。少数的几次合作开发也还不算太麻烦(虽然交叉文件修改的很头大)。

    最近的项目代码比较多,每次保存都要100M左右的空间,而且要维护几个版本,修改起来更是头疼,就想用一个版本控制软件。

    刚开始装了个cvsnt,在头疼于麻烦的设置时候看到很多人说svn更好,还有git,不过据说git门槛较高。所以我两个工具都装上。

    git变得妇孺皆知,一部分原因是Linux之父对C++进行了炮轰,从而引发圣战,其根源就是git,
    见http://www.51cto.com/art/200709/56340.htm

    c++的奥秘在语言之内,c语言的奥秘在语言之外,相对来讲,C语言更直观,更简单。C语言用不好的原因要么就是白纸新手,要么就是对项目理解不到位。用了近十年C,才对它的优缺点稍有感触

    可能是这个原因,git的速度确实很快,上千个文件,nM空间,commit一下几秒就好了。而windows下复制一下也要几十m。

    几个不错的介绍git的网址
入门级
http://www.qweruiop.org/nchcrails/posts/49
手册型
http://www.zeuux.org/science/learning-git.cn.html



   


路过

鸡蛋

鲜花

握手

雷人

评论 (0 个评论)